Indiana Bitcoin Rights Bill clears legislature, awaits governor’s signature
Indiana lawmakers have passed the Bitcoin Rights Bill, HB 1042, which allows cryptocurrency investment options in public retirement plans and protects individual digital asset access. The bill awaits Governor Mike Braun’s approval and, if signed, will take effect on July 1, 2026, reflecting a growing institutional adoption of Bitcoin.

$61M in stolen crypto seized in North Carolina fraud crackdown
Federal prosecutors in North Carolina seized over $61 million in Tether linked to a romance-style investment fraud scheme known as “pig butchering.” Homeland Security Investigations traced stolen funds to multiple crypto wallets controlled by criminals. The operation reflects ongoing U.S. efforts to crack down on cryptocurrency fraud and money laundering.

Bitcoin falls from $66k to $65k after Trump ignores crypto in state of the union address
Bitcoin initially rose in anticipation of Trump mentioning it in his State of the Union address, reaching around $66k before dropping to $65k when he did not. Despite Peter Schiff’s warning of a potential sell-off, the price only experienced a modest decline after the speech, leading to short-term market fluctuations.

Meta to plug Stripe stablecoins into Facebook, Instagram, WhatsApp in 2026
Meta plans to integrate stablecoin payments for creator payouts on its social media platforms by the second half of 2026, partnering with Stripe’s Bridge platform. This initiative aims to reduce costs for international transfers and accelerate payouts, positioning Meta against competitors like X and Telegram. Glassnode flags extended sell-side pressure ahead
Bitcoin’s price has dropped by around 28% this month, with Glassnode’s sub-1 realized profit/loss ratio indicating the potential for 5-6 more months of downward pressure. The historical data suggests that when this ratio falls below 1, Bitcoin’s price could continue to decline for an extended period.

South Korea targets finfluencers with strict asset disclosure law
South Korea is planning a new law that would require financial influencers to disclose their personal asset holdings and compensation when recommending stocks or cryptocurrencies. The aim is to prevent market manipulation and protect investors by increasing transparency and imposing penalties for violations.
